祁连山浅山区造林技术试验

摘    要:通过对祁连山浅山区影响造林成活、生长的树种选择、混交方式、生长调节剂处理等因子开展试验研究,结果表明:浅山区造林树种的选择对成活率的影响较大,成活率相差近10个百分点;GGR处理对成活率、生长量有一定的影响,其成活率可提高13个百分点,科翰95保水剂不同施入方法,对成活率影响明显,其排序为水溶300倍液穴施150 g水溶蘸根粉施20 g;干旱区同一树种根系套袋造林其成活率影响比较明显,成活率提高11个百分点,年新梢生长量平均提高2.0 cm,干梢率下降10个百分点。

关 键 词:祁连山浅山地区  造林技术  试验
